Job Description



Job Summary



  • Our client is looking for a proactive and analytical Finance Officer to join their dynamic team.

  • The Finance Officer will play a crucial role in ensuring the financial health and integrity of the company.

  • This individual will be responsible for managing financial records, preparing financial statements, ensuring compliance with tax regulations, and providing insightful analysis to support management decisions.

  • The role requires a detail-oriented individual with a strong background in finance and accounting, particularly within the software industry.


Key Responsibilities

Cash Management:



  • Liaise with the Finance Manager on day-to-day cash management activities.

  • Implement and maintain the company's finance policies in line with industry best practices.


Financial Reporting:



  • Maintain accurate and up-to-date financial records.

  • Prepare financial statements in compliance with accounting standards, managing the month-end and year-end closing processes.


Budgeting and Forecasting:



  • Prepare budgets and forecasts.

  • Analyze financial variances and provide actionable recommendations to management.


Tax Compliance:



  • Ensure timely filing of tax returns and compliance with all relevant tax regulations.

  • Coordinate with external auditors and fulfill all audit requirements.


Financial Analysis:



  • Analyze financial data to identify trends and forecast future performance.

  • Provide strategic recommendations to improve the company's financial performance.


Internal Controls:



  • Implement and monitor strong internal controls to prevent fraud and errors.

  • Ensure compliance with accounting standards, regulations, and laws.


Financial Planning and Analysis:



  • Provide financial planning and analysis support to management.

  • Identify growth opportunities and recommend strategies to enhance financial performance.


Payroll and Compliance:



  • Assist in preparing staff payroll and ensure compliance with relevant regulatory authorities.

  • Manage documentation and compliance for Insurance, Pension, and HMO.


Requirements

Education:



  • Bachelor’s Degree or equivalent in Finance, Accounting, or a related discipline.

  • ICAN or ACA certification is an added advantage.


Experience:



  • 2-5 years of experience in a related field, preferably in the software or IT industry.

  • Strong experience in Financial Reporting, Tax, and Auditing.


Skills:



  • Proficiency in Microsoft Office Suite (Word, Excel, PowerPoint).

  • Proficiency in accounting software, such as SAGE.

  • Excellent math, data entry, and analytical skills.

  • Strong communication skills, both oral and written.

  • Ability to multitask, work under minimal supervision, and attention to detail.


Additional Qualifications:



  • Knowledge of IT is an added advantage.
